April the Giraffe gave birth to a male calf Saturday morning while the whole world watched.
The latest update from the 15-year-old giraffe's keepers at Animal Adventure Park in New York is that "all is well" after the birth.

Now, the new giraffe needs a name. The zoo is holding a naming contest, which you can join here. You have to pay $1 to vote. The giraffe keepers say it's all going to charity:
Funds raised will be split:
1) Giraffe Conservation Efforts in the wild
We will continue to build towards our banked contribution to the Giraffe Conservation Foundation.
2) Ava's Little Heroes
An event named after the daughter of the park owners, who suffers from a rare form of epilepsy. The funds generated for this annual campaign support local families and their children experiencing unexpected medical journeys and expenses.
3) Animal Adventure
The park will continue to improve the animal and guest experiences at the park with further improvements and projects - helping further our message and mission of education.
